Title:
Receive New Community Profile and One Page Brochure
Purpose/Background:
The purpose of this case is to present the new Community Profile and revised Brochure for prospective developers and businesses. This is an informational item and no formal action is required by the EDA.
Staff has been working to develop a one-page community profile and a revised brochure to replace the interactive Economic Development Guide to be used for marketing. Staff has moved toward a more simple solution based on feedback from businesses and other resources used by other communities. The number of pages on the revised brochure has been reduced from the 42 - page printable (23 page - interactive) Economic Development Brochure rolled out in 2019 and has been updated periodically. Staff plans to remove the interactive document from the website toward the end of the year as it is outdated and has turned out to be very difficult to update. These new documents can be used for introductory prospect meetings and business visits conducted by Economic Development Manager Sullivan and others. The new documents are also easier to update with current information. The new brochures are not designed to market individual sites, they are used for community background and higher level data that brokers and site selectors are looking for. All City-owned sites are marketed individually on MNCAR, Co-star / Loopnet, The City Website and Lasso (By LOIS, DEED) so these new documents supplement that marketing initiative.
Staff is currently using these new documents for business visits and new prospects. If there are suggestions for additions or subtractions to these documents, please contact Economic Development Manager Sullivan to provide feedback for future updates.
